Bob Gibson ha inventato la salsa Alabama White oltre 100 anni fa e ancora oggi rimane un condimento basilare dei barbecue nei backyard dell'Alabama settentrionale. Ha infatti combinato ingredienti un po' unici e solitamente non utilizzati come base delle tradizionali salse barbecue.

Alabama Sunshine produces three types of salsa — it's original, traditional recipe; a no-sugar-added garden salsa, and a black bean and corn variety. Like many businesses, it's still struggling with the aftereffects of the COVID-19 pandemic, which disrupted supply chains and made it difficult to find glass jars and some species of pepper.
